Illescas Cordoba - Andersson Ubeda 1997 Black to move
1...Qc5!
Unity Chess Club
Correctly estimating that White's attack can be parried by a "brave king" manoeuvre.
Unity Chess Club
2.Rh3 Kg8! 3.Bxf6 Bxf6 4.Qxh7+ Kf8 5.Qh8+
Unity Chess Club
Other moves permit Black to consolidate by 5...Re5!.
Unity Chess Club
5...Ke7 6.Qh5 Rd7!
Unity Chess Club
. Preparing 7...Kd8. By now the king is out of danger, whereas White has problems on the back rank. Black went on to win after
Unity Chess Club
7.Re1+ Kd8 8.Rxe8+ Kxe8 9.Qh8+ Ke7
Unity Chess Club
followed by ...d5-d4.

Matovic - Hellsten Belgrade 2002 Black to move
1...e5!
Unity Chess Club
Clearing the centre for the bishop pair.
Unity Chess Club
2.Rae1
Unity Chess Club
2.dxe5?! dxe5 3.f5 e4! Black is clearly better.
Unity Chess Club
2...Rf8! 3.fxe5 dxe5 4.dxe5 Bxe5+ 5.Kg1
Unity Chess Club
5.Rxe5? Rxd2 6.R5e2 Rf2! with decisive pressure.
Unity Chess Club
5...Bg3 6.Rf1 Rfe8 7.Rxe8+ Rxe8
Unity Chess Club
Intending 8...Re2 with a huge plus.
